Genetic, physiological, and lifestyle predictors of mortality in the general population.
American journal of public health - 1 Apr 2012
Walter Stefan, Mackenbach Johan, Vokó Zoltán, Lhachimi Stefan, Ikram M Arfan, Uitterlinden André G, Newman Anne B, Murabito Joanne M, Garcia Melissa E, Gudnason Vilmundur, Tanaka Toshiko, Tranah Gregory J, Wallaschofski Henri, Kocher Thomas, Launer Lenore J, Franceschini Nora, Schipper Maarten, Hofman Albert, Tiemeier Henning
Abstract excerpt
OBJECTIVES: We investigated the quality of 162 variables, focusing on the contribution of genetic markers, used solely or in combination with other characteristics, when predicting mortality. METHODS: In 5974 participants from the Rotterdam Study, followed for a median of 15.1 years, 7 groups of...
